Perpignan's personality is deeply rooted in its Catalan heritage, evident in its architecture, cuisine, and festivals. The city serves as a gateway to both the Mediterranean Sea and the Pyrenees mountains, offering a diverse range of activities from beach relaxation to mountain hikes. Its historic center, with the Palace of the Kings of Majorca, tells tales of a rich past, while its modern amenities provide all the conveniences for a comfortable stay. Local tips
- Book your villa well in advance, especially if traveling during peak season (July-August) to secure the best options in the Perpignan area.
- Consider renting a car to fully explore the region, including the Mediterranean coast, the Pyrenees, and the charming villages of the Roussillon.
- Utilize the villa's kitchen facilities to prepare meals with fresh, local produce from Perpignan's markets, experiencing authentic Catalan cuisine.
- Take advantage of private amenities like pools and terraces for relaxing evenings after a day of sightseeing in the Pyrénées-Orientales.
- Research the villa's exact location relative to Perpignan's city center and attractions to plan your transportation effectively.
